I got 2 ingredient packs with my brewing kit and one was a "Trippel XXX Belgian Ale" from Alternative Beverage. This was before I learned about the wide variety amongst tripels. If I make it and get something approximating Gouden Carolus I'll be ecstatic. Chimay Tripel is great too. If it's more like Victory Golden Monkey I'll be very disappointed. (I ordered one in a bar and the waitress was kind enough to take it back when she saw the look on my face). I also couldn't finish a Brother David's tripel.
My beer vocabulary isn't developed yet but I thought Golden Monkey was way too dark and Brother David was sour.
I know it isn't a Tripel but my absolute favorite beer is Duvel.
This may be an unfair question but can any of you tell what sort of beer these ingredients might yield? I'm happy to go out and buy some other hops or specialty grains but don't want to have to spring for a whole new DME.
8# Extra Light Dried Malt Extract
1# Belgian Candi Sugar - Light
3 cups Specialty Malt - Belgian CaraVienne
2oz Hallertauer bittering Pellet hops - Add at boil
1 tab Whirlfloc - 35 minutes
1oz Saaz finishing Pellet hops - 20 minutes later (total 55)
Yeast - choose from
Liquid - White Labs WLP550
Dry - Safbrew #S-33
